Sugar coat khaja
#golden apron2 khaja is a very femous recipe of puri in orissa.it can store in airtight containers upto 2 weeks.

Cooking instructions
* Step 1
First, take flour in pot.
* Step 3
Mix both of them together
* Step 5
Then,knead the flour with hand.
* Step 7
After that the dough will soft
* Step 8
The dough cut in to 4 equal parts.
* Step 9
Roll the ball by rolling pin.
* Step 10
Roll each dough ball into circle shape.
* Step 11
After rolling one ball,put it in a plate.
* Step 12
Grease ghee on the flour sheet.
* Step 13
Then,spread the flour on the grease ghee in the sheet.
* Step 14
Roll another ball similarly.
* Step 15
Put it on the top of the first circle sheet.
* Step 16
Then,grease ghee and spread flour on the top of second sheet.
* Step 17
Next,roll third circle sheet
* Step 19
Then grease ghee once again
* Step 21
Roll the last circle sheet
* Step 23
Then,stick all the edges of the sheets into equal shape.
* Step 24
Then,all the flour sheet roll together tightly to resemble a log.
* Step 25
Cut the flour log into equal size pieces of 1 inch each.
* Step 26
Roll each pieces by rolling pin with some flour.
* Step 27
Now,heat enough oil in deep fry pan.
* Step 28
Fry all of them one by one on medium flame
* Step 29
Untill they have turn golden brown on both sides.
* Step 31
Next, take two cup sugar and 1 cup water in a sauce pan for syrup with cardamom powder.
* Step 32
After that, bring it to boil in oven.
* Step 33
Untill cook it becomes sticky.
* Step 34
Dip the fried khaja into the syrup when the syrup is still warm.
* Step 35
After 2 min,take the well coat khajas in a plate.
